新手搭建网站应该选择哪种服务器系统镜像?

新手搭建网站,推荐选择 Ubuntu Server(LTS 版本,如 22.04 LTS 或 24.04 LTS)作为服务器操作系统镜像。理由如下:

为什么 Ubuntu 是最佳入门选择?

  1. 社区庞大、文档丰富

    • 中文教程极多(如腾讯云/阿里云官方文档、Bilibili 视频、CSDN、知乎、GitHub Guides),遇到问题几乎“一搜就有解”。
    • 官方文档清晰(https://ubuntu.com/server/docs),且有活跃的中文论坛和 Stack Overflow 支持。
  2. 稳定 + 长期支持(LTS)

    • LTS 版本提供 5 年安全更新与维护(如 22.04 LTS 支持至 2027年4月),适合新手无需频繁升级系统。
  3. 软件生态完善,一键部署便捷

    • apt 包管理器简单可靠,安装 Nginx/Apache/MySQL/PHP/Node.js 等 Web 常用服务仅需几条命令:
      sudo apt update && sudo apt install nginx mysql-server php-fpm php-mysql
    • 兼容主流建站工具:WordPress(一键脚本)、宝塔面板(可视化管理)、Docker、Laravel、Hugo 等。
  4. 云平台默认首选 & 兼容性好

    • 阿里云、腾讯云、华为云、AWS、DigitalOcean 等均将 Ubuntu LTS 列为首推/默认镜像,驱动、内核、控制台兼容性最优,避免新手踩坑(如网卡识别、SSH 登录异常等)。
  5. 安全性与更新机制成熟

    • 自动安全更新可轻松启用(sudo apt install unattended-upgrades),降低运维门槛。

⚠️ 其他常见选项对比(供参考):

系统 适合新手吗? 说明
CentOS Stream / Rocky Linux / AlmaLinux ❌ 不推荐初学 CentOS 已停止传统版本;替代品虽稳定但文档/中文支持弱于 Ubuntu,dnf 命令略复杂,部分教程过时。适合进阶或企业环境。
Debian ⚠️ 可选,但稍逊 Ubuntu 更稳定保守,但软件包版本较旧(如 PHP/Nginx 版本低),新手可能需手动编译或加第三方源,增加复杂度。
Windows Server ❌ 强烈不推荐(除非必须跑 ASP.NET/.NET Framework) 成本高(需授权)、资源占用大、命令行/运维逻辑与 Linux 差异大,学习曲线陡峭,且绝大多数开源建站方案(WordPress、Typecho、Hexo 等)天然适配 Linux。
CloudLinux / cPanel 专用系统 ❌ 新手勿碰 面向主机商,封闭性强,学习价值低,且通常需付费授权。

💡 给新手的实用建议:

  • ✅ 选 Ubuntu 22.04 LTS 或 24.04 LTS(64位)镜像(优先 22.04,因 24.04 较新,部分面板/插件可能暂未完全适配);
  • ✅ 初期可搭配「宝塔面板」(免费版)图形化管理(支持 Ubuntu),降低命令行恐惧,同时逐步学习基础 Linux 操作;
  • ✅ 务必设置 密钥登录 + 禁用 root 密码登录 + 配置 UFW 防火墙,保障基础安全;
  • ✅ 所有操作先备份快照(云服务器控制台一键创建),大胆试错不慌。

📌 总结一句话:

Ubuntu LTS = 新手最友好、资源最丰富、风险最低、成长路径最平滑的选择。先跑起来,再深入理解——这才是高效入门的正道。

需要我为你提供一份「Ubuntu + Nginx + MySQL + PHP(LNMP)一键部署脚本」或「宝塔面板安装指南」,欢迎随时告诉我 😊

未经允许不得转载:CLOUD云枢 » 新手搭建网站应该选择哪种服务器系统镜像?